Yoshi's is always straight down from wherever it hits...sinilar to Kirby's down air

At the end of DK's fist it hits straight down and slightly on an angle to the opposite direction of the first

At the top of the "arm" area, it hits the same way as the fist...just on the opposite side

At the top of the fist (as in above the head) it hits straight down...completely down

Basically, the more the move is through...the more it hits the opponent to the opposite direction
